What part of the respiratory tract is considered the respiratory zone?
A. Bronchioles
B. Larynx
C. Trachea
D. Alveoli

Answers

Answer:

D. Alveoli

Explanation:

Functionally, the respiratory system is separated into a conducting zone and respiratory zone:

Conducting zone consists of the nose, pharynx, larynx, trachea, bronchi, and bronchioles. These structures form a continuous passageway for air to move in and out of the lungs.

Respiratory zone is found deep inside the lungs and is made up of the respiratory bronchioles, alveolar ducts, and alveoli. These thin-walled structures allow inhaled oxygen (O2) to diffuse into the lung capillaries in exchange for carbon dioxide (CO2).

The respiratory zone begins where the terminal bronchioles join a respiratory bronchiole, the smallest type of bronchiole, which then leads to an alveolar duct, opening into a cluster of alveoli.

What role do the oceans play in moderating climate change?
Group of answer choices

A. Oceans help to reduce the level of water vapor in the atmosphere through condensation.

B. Oceans absorb about 40% of the methane out of the atmosphere that has been produced by rice paddies and livestock.

C, Oceans remove about 25% of the atmospheric carbon dioxide produced by humans.

D. Oceans reflect sunlight back into space before the ultraviolet wavelengths are converted into infrared radiation.

Answers

Oceans absorb 25% of CO2

The role that the oceans play in moderating climate change is as follows:

Oceans remove about 25% of the atmospheric carbon dioxide produced by humans.

Thus, the correct option for this question is C.

What is Climatic change?

Climatic change may be defined as a type of process that significantly involves long-term alterations in the temperature and weather pattern of a particular location. These alterations are completely natural and rely upon the solar cycle.

The role of the oceans is determined by the fact that they regulate the climate of particular locations by absorbing 25-30% of the carbon produced by humans in the environment. Due to this, they are considered the largest store of carbon accounting for approximately 83% of the global carbon cycle.

Therefore, oceans remove about 25% of the atmospheric carbon dioxide produced by humans is the statement that represents the role of oceans that play in moderating climate change. Thus, the correct option for this question is C.

A planet is at equal distance from two stars, Star 1 and Star 2. If both stars have the same mass,

they will not pull each other with a gravitational force
they will pull the planet with equal gravitational force
Star 1 will pull the planet with a greater gravitational force than Star 2
Star 2 will pull the planet with a greater gravitational force than Star 1

Answers

Answer:

In this situation both o the stars will pull the planet with equal gravitational force.

Explanation:

The reason behind this is that gravity works according to the mass an object has. Therefore if we have two corpses with the same amount of mass they are going to pull the objects with the same strength. Now, in our case, they have a planet between both of them. Thus, they are going to pull it to them with the same gravitational force because they have the same mass, and are at the same distance. If one of them had a bigger mass that would pull the planet with more gravitational force, as well as if that star was closer to the planet.
